Dean Day in Moscow with Michael Angelo Batio and K.M.E. line array and monitors

Michael Angelo Batio at Dean Day in Moscow 2008 Again, a Dean Day attracted an enthusiastic audience celeberating great guitar sounds: This time during Music Moscow 2008, headlining Michael Angelo Batio and his band Hands Without Shadows as well as Sergey Mavrin and the band Black Obelisk. Michael Angelo Batio is one of the fastest guitar players in the world and can play two guitars attached at their bodies simultaneously.
The Russian distribution company MixArt Distribution organized the event and used a K.M.E. Pano line array system consisting of eight line array subs QLB 118 plus four line source units QL 906 as FOH and two QL 1215 as down-fills. The monitoring was provided by CLP 320. CA 7 served as side-fill.
An audience of 1500, musicians and sound engineers were very pleased with the performance of the whole system, and praised the Pano's accurate and powerful reproduction.
